Title

E- BANKING AND FINANCIAL PERFORMANCE OF PUBLIC SECTOR BANKS IN INDIA

Authors

Abstract

Banking sector has become highly competitive due to the changes in bank’s external environment including globalization and de-regulation. Banks’ find it hard to compete on price and requires looking at different ways to retain customers. As customers have become more knowledgeable, it becomes vitally important for banks to contemplate the use of technology to respond to the constant changing requirements. But current scenario, in India shows that the pace at which technology in e-banking is growing doesn’t match with the customer usage rate, even after the banks are more interested in adopting new technology. In today’s technological world, customers expect instant solutions for everything including banking activities for a simplified life. Banking industry in India are deploying the information technology and developing the service quality for the customers on a large extent. To overcome the competition and retain their customers, banks need to focus on their E-Banking facilities. This study is based on the secondary data collected from the annual reports of the banks and reports of Reserve Bank of India on the selected banks. The banks under study are State owned bank-State Bank of India and Public sector bank - Canara bank. The data under study is considered for 5 financial years starting 2013 -2014 to 2017 - 2018. Data is analysed using SSPS Version 25 with the use of correlation analysis for dependent variables. The study finally concludes that there exist a positive relationship between introduction of e-banking and financial performance
